Good Sam RA Two Issues Maybe

I keep my coach in a nearby storage facility. It won't start...barely turns over....even with a jump starter rated for more liters than the engine. Could be batteries (they have recent dates) or maybe the starter. GS RA offers jump starts but what if it won't jump start and needs towing to a repair center. Are both covered? I plan to call them but wonder what the collective thinks.

A big diesel like your Bus needs a LOT more cranking amps than any gas engine - it has more than 2x the compression. So those jump boxes aren't really up to the job. Get the generator started and let it run a few hours, charging the house batteries, then use the built-in jump aux/emergency start for the engine.
